    Montessori Program Manager / Lead Guide

    Job Description

    Petal Path Montessori-Inspired Enrichment is seeking a warm, organized, and passionate Montessori Program Manager / Lead Guide to help lead and grow our child-centered program serving children ages 2–12.

    This role combines hands-on guiding of children with program leadership and coordination. We are looking for someone who loves creating prepared environments, supporting child independence, and helping build a positive, collaborative team culture. The right candidate enjoys both direct work with children and behind-the-scenes organization to help programs run smoothly.

    This is an excellent opportunity for a Montessori educator or early childhood professional who wants to help shape a growing program and make a meaningful impact.

    Responsibilities

    • Lead Montessori-inspired enrichment classes and guide children through purposeful, developmentally appropriate activities

    • Maintain a calm, engaging, and prepared learning environment

    • Support curriculum planning and program structure

    • Coordinate class schedules, materials, and daily program flow

    • Provide guidance and support to instructors and team members

    • Communicate professionally with families and help create a welcoming community environment

    • Assist with program development, quality improvement, and ongoing growth initiatives

    Qualifications

    • Experience working with children in a Montessori, early childhood, or enrichment setting

    • Strong understanding of child development and child-led learning

    • Leadership, organization, and communication skills

    • Ability to create a positive, calm, and nurturing environment

    • Montessori training or certification preferred 

    • Program coordination or leadership experience is a plus
